What happens to a life insurance policy if a couple gets divorced?

  1. The policy is automatically terminated.

  2. The policy remains in effect, but the ex-spouse is no longer the beneficiary.

  3. The policy is divided equally between the ex-spouses.

  4. The policy is sold, and the proceeds are divided between the ex-spouses.


Correct Option: B
Explanation:

In most cases, a life insurance policy remains in effect after a divorce, but the ex-spouse is no longer the beneficiary. The policy owner can change the beneficiary to a new person, such as a child or a new spouse.

What are the legal considerations related to life insurance during and after divorce?

  1. The court may order one spouse to maintain life insurance for the benefit of the other spouse.

  2. The court may order the division of the cash value of a life insurance policy.

  3. The court may order the transfer of a life insurance policy from one spouse to the other.

  4. All of the above.


Correct Option: D
Explanation:

The court may order one spouse to maintain life insurance for the benefit of the other spouse, order the division of the cash value of a life insurance policy, or order the transfer of a life insurance policy from one spouse to the other.
